Time | UVI | Category | Time to Burn |
---|---|---|---|
07: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
08:00 | 3 | moderate | 30 min |
09:00 | 6 | high | 25 min |
10:00 | 10 | very high | 15 min |
11:00 | 13 | extreme | 10 min |
12:00 | 15 | extreme | 10 min |
13:00 | 14 | extreme | 10 min |
14:00 | 11 | extreme | 10 min |
15:00 | 8 | very high | 15 min |
16:00 | 4 | moderate | 30 min |
17:00 | 2 | low | 45 min |
18: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
19:00 | 0 | low | 45 min |
Throughout the year, UV levels fluctuate significantly, with the highest readings occurring from March through October. The risk of UV exposure is particularly elevated from February to October, with March to September classified as extreme. Notably, July reaches a peak UV Index of 15, demanding utmost caution during outdoor activities, with a burn time of just 10 minutes. Visitors and residents should prioritize skin protection by wearing sunscreen, protective clothing, and seeking shade during these high-risk months, especially from February to September. As the year transitions into the cooler months, UV exposure diminishes, tapering off to very high in November and December, but still necessitating vigilance when outdoors.
